THE LIONS OF WINTER, by TY GAGNE:
Two weeks ago there was a book presentation and signing at the local Pope Memorial Library in Conway by Ty Gagne about his newest book. This is an in-depth analysis of the lead up to and aftermath of the death of Albert Dow and subsequent rescue of Hugh Herr and Jeff Batzer. The story has been told and retold, and there even was a recent short film about the Mountain Rescue Service and this episode:
